Volume Control
Set the MAIN ZONE volume 
setting.
Volume Display : Set how volume is displayed.
 Relative : Display ---dB (Min), in the range –80 dB ~ 18 dB.
Absolute : Display in the range 0 (Min) ~ 99.
 The “Volume Display” setting is applied also to the “Volume Limit” and 
“Power On Level” display method. 
The “Volume Display” setting applies to all zones.

Volume Limit : Make a setting for maximum volume
OFF : Do not set a maximum volume.
–20dB (61) / –10dB (71) / 0dB (81)

Power  On  Level  :  Define  the  volume  setting  that  is  active  when  the 
power is turned on.
Last : Use the memorized setting from the last session.
– – – (0) : Always use the muting on condition when power is turned on.
–80dB ~ 18dB (1 ~ 99) : The volume is adjusted to the set level.

Mute Level : Set the amount of attenuation when muting is on.
 Full : The sound is muted entirely.
–40dB : The sound is attenuated by 40 dB down.
–20dB : The sound is attenuated by 20 dB down.

Source Delete
Remove  input  sources 
that  are  not  used  from  the 
display.
PHONO  /  CD  /  DVD  /  HDP  /  TV  /  SAT/CBL  /  VCR  /  DVR  /  V.AUX  /  
NET/USB / TUNER / XM / SIRIUS / HD Radio : Select input source that 
is not used.
ON : Use this source.
Delete : Do not use this source.
NOTE
 Input sources being used in the various zones cannot be deleted.
 Input  sources  set  to  “Delete”  cannot  be  selected  using  SOURCE 
SELECT.

GUI
Make GUI related settings.
Screensaver : Make screensaver settings.
 ON : The screen saver is activated during GUI menu display or NET/USB 
/ iPod / TUNER / XM / SIRIUS / HD Radio screen display if no operation 
is performed approximately for a continuous 3-minute period. When you 
press uio p, the  screen  saver  is  cancelled  and the screen before 
that screen saver started is displayed.
OFF : Screen saver is not activated.

Format  :  Set  the  video  signal  format  to  be  output  for  the  TV  you  are 
using. 
NTSC : Select NTSC output.
PAL : Select PAL output.
  The “Format” can also be set by the following procedure. However, 
the GUI screen is not displayed.
1.  Press  and  hold  the  main  unit’s  DSX  and  RETURN  for  at  least  3 
seconds.
  “Video Format” appears on the display.
2. Press o p and set the video signal format.
3.  Press  the main unit’s  ENTER, MENU or  RETURN to complete  the 
setting.
NOTE
When a format other than the video format of the connected TV is set, the 
picture will not be displayed properly.

Master Volume : Master volume display during adjustment.
Bottom : Display at the bottom.
Top : Display at the top.
OFF : Turn display off.
 When the master volume display is hard to see when superimposed 
on movie subtitles, set to “Top”.
